Why does the Bible say not to love in word only?

Answered in 1 source

Loving in word only is empty; true love must be demonstrated through actions.

The Bible cautions against loving in word only, as seen in 1 John 3:18. This admonition speaks to the superficiality of merely expressing affection verbally without backing it up with genuine actions. True love is characterized by active involvement and support in the lives of our brethren, embodying the love of Christ. When we reduce love to merely spoken words, we neglect its deeper meaning and fail to fulfill the commandment to love one another truly. Love must manifest in deeds and in the truth of our relationships, reflecting a commitment to God and to each other.
Scripture References: 1 John 3:18
